<?xml version="1.0" encoding="utf-8" ?><rss version="2.0" xmlns:atom="http://www.w3.org/2005/Atom" xmlns:r="https://r-universe.dev"><channel><title>indagoverse.r-universe.dev</title><link>https://indagoverse.r-universe.dev</link><description>Recent package updates in indagoverse</description><generator>R-universe</generator><image><url>https://github.com/indagoverse.png</url><title>R packages by indagoverse</title><link>https://indagoverse.r-universe.dev</link></image><lastBuildDate>Sat, 10 Jan 2026 10:52:03 GMT</lastBuildDate><item><title>[indagoverse] inDAGO 1.0.3</title><author>fruggierocarmine3@gmail.com (Carmine Fruggiero)</author><description>A 'shiny' app that supports both dual and bulk RNA-seq,
with the dual RNA-seq functionality offering the flexibility to
perform either a sequential approach (where reads are mapped
separately to each genome) or a combined approach (where reads
are aligned to a single merged genome). The user-friendly
interface automates the analysis process, providing
step-by-step guidance, making it easy for users to navigate
between different analysis steps, and download intermediate
results and publication-ready plots.</description><link>https://github.com/r-universe/indagoverse/actions/runs/27189873227</link><pubDate>Sat, 10 Jan 2026 10:52:03 GMT</pubDate><r:package>inDAGO</r:package><r:version>1.0.3</r:version><r:status>success</r:status><r:repository>https://indagoverse.r-universe.dev</r:repository><r:upstream>https://github.com/indagoverse/indago</r:upstream></item></channel></rss>
